PUTNAM — Two Wilkinson Street resident were arrested on drug charges May 13 by Troop-D Quality of Life Task Force, the Putnam Police Department, the Statewide Narcotics Task Force-East Office, and personnel assigned to the Troop D Danielson Barracks
Kayla Cassidy, 22, of 47 Wilkinson Street, Apt. 2A, and Brandon Lee, 34, of the same address were charged with  possession of narcotics and possession of narcotics with intent to sell.
Police officials obtained a search warrant after an investigation revealed that Cassidy and Lee were selling heroin from their residence.  When entry was made into the residence, Lee and Cassidy were located in the living room of the apartment.  A search was then conducted and heroin, packaging material, cash and drug notes were located and seized.  
This investigation was a joint effort by the Connecticut State Police and the Putnam Police Department and was in response to numerous complaints by the citizens of Putnam of heavy narcotic related traffic in and around the Wilkinson Street neighborhood.
